![]() View sample in GitHub Set simplified layout Public class ItemTemplateSelector : DataTemplateSelector The RibbonWindow allows you to customize the visual appearance of each item with different templates based on specific constraints by using the HeaderItemTemplateSelector. The RibbonWindow allows you to customize the visual appearance of the custom items stored in the HeaderItemsSource using HeaderItemTemplate property. The HeaderItemsSource property of the RibbonWindow allows you to bind a collection of objects which used to load custom controls into the right side of the title bar. The HeaderItems property of the RibbonWindow allows you to load any controls directly into the title bar. The RibbonWindow allows to load any custom controls into the right side of the title bar by using both HeaderItems and HeaderItemsSource property. Here two RibbonButton with its Label property as “Options” and “Exits” are added as ApplicationMenuItems. Different ApplicationItems are added to an application menu using its ApplicationItems property. and BackStage is not applicable when ApplicationMenu is used in Ribbon.Īdd application items to the application menuĪpplicationItems are displayed in bottom of the Application menu. Visual style is set to Default for RibbonWindow in SkinStorage. Using the ApplicationMenu property of the Ribbon, this Menu is viewed by added at the top-left corner of the window. To show the BackStage by, click the FILE Menu in Ribbon like in Microsoft Outlook.Īn Application Menu contains standard commands that are performed like in Microsoft Outlook 2003 UI. QATMenuItems property of QuickAccessToolbar used to add items to Dropdown menu of QAT.īackStage can be added by using BackStage property of Ribbon. Also it can be placed above or below the ribbon. QuickAccessToolbar (QAT) is used to group the frequently used commands and access the commands easily without having to search for the command in the menu bar. Here, “Find” RibbonBar holds a RibbonComboBox with a caption as “Filter Email” using its Label property also holding items like and Add QAT RibbonComboBox is used to display the list of items.It accepts ComboBoxItems as its children. ![]() Also ItemHeight, ItemWidth properties are used to set height and width respectively. Here, “QuickSteps” RibbonBar holds a RibbonGallery with InRibbon visual mode to place gallery items with in Ribbon. ![]() ![]() RibbonGallery displays items with good look and feel and it also used to classify the items as groups for easy navigation. It also provides SizeForm property for different sizes. Here, “Delete” RibbonBar holds a SplitButton with a caption as “Clean Up” using its Label property also holding items like “Clean Up Folder”, “Clean Up Conversation” and “Clean Up Folder/SubFolder”. It accepts DropDownMenuItem as its children. It displays some items while click on it. SplitButton also appears with a drop arrow. Here, “New” RibbonBar holds a DropDownButton with a caption as “New Items” using its Label property also holding items like “E-mail Message”, “Appointment”, “Meeting”, “Contact” and “Task”. It displays some items, while click on it. Add DropDownButtonĭropDownButton appears like normal button that contains a drop arrow. Image of any size has been used for RibbonButton and also it supports image of all formats. Similarly,image of 32 * 32 has been compressed to 16 * 16 if SizeForm is ExtraSmall. If the value of SizeForm is large,then image of 16 * 16 size has been expanded to 32 * 32 automatically. Here, “New” RibbonBar holds a RibbonButton with a caption as “New Email” using its Label property.It also provides SizeForm property for different sizes. RibbonButton provides functionalities like normal Button. Include an XML namespace for the SfSkinManager assembly to the MainWindow. Refer the following assemblies with the project ![]() To apply Visual Studio style on the current layout, refer to the following steps. Ribbon supports various visual styles by using the SfSkinManager. ![]()
0 Comments
Leave a Reply. |